An important Butte County fire prevention organization is asking the community for help. The Butte County Fire Safe Council is being denied reimbursement for a project that's costing the council more than $100,000. The Butte County Fire Safe Council works on fire safety projects county-wide. The council is concerned about a finished 18-month project that has not been completely reimbursed. The council applied for the Wildland Urban Interface grant in July 2013 which totals to $260,855. The grant was designed to be a partnership with Yankee Hill Fire Safe Council.
